OT: Odom #3 paid player

Lamar Odom will be doing pretty well financially if the rumored trade to LA goes down.

[My best guess on numbers follows]

In 2003-04, his base salary was $7.796 million. In addition, he was paid a signing bonus of $13.000 million

Because of the trade kicker in his contract, if he's traded, Odom will make $8.144 million as a base salary and will get a $8.256 million payment as a result of the trade kicker.

That's $37.196 million that he will have made in two seasons. Only Shaq and Garnett make more money over that same two year period.
